Germany Opportunity Card

Germany has launched the new Opportunity Card that allows candidates from non-EU countries to enter Germany and look for employment without a permanent job contract. Germany Opportunity Card aims to attract skilled workers by simplifying the process. Candidates must score at least six points in a points-based system to get the Opportunity Card. The Opportunity Card makes the process easier, legal entry to Germany, chance to earn good income, and provides the potential for permanent residency. This initiative of new Opportunity Card simplifies the job search process in Germany.

How to Calculate Your Points for the Opportunity Card

To qualify for the German Opportunity Card, candidates need a total of six points in the points based system. The points system analyses language skills, professional experience, age, and connection to Germany. Basic requirements include language proficiency and financial stability, provided by an employment contract for part-time work.

  • Four points are awarded for partial recognition of foreign professional qualifications or permission to practice controlled professions such as engineering or teaching.
  • Three points are given for professionals having 5 years of experience within the last seven years or good German language skills at B2 level.
  • Two points are awarded for professionals having 2 years of experience following vocational training, or if the candidate is under 35 years old, and for German language skills at B1 level.
  • One point is given for candidates under 40 years old or those with previous stays in Germany, excluding tourist visits.
  • Additional points are available for very good English skills (C1), reasonable German skills (A2), qualifications in shortage occupations, or joint applications with a spouses.

Steps to apply for German Opportunity Card

Step 1:Check your eligibility as per the Opportunity card points-based system.

Step 2:Collect necessary documents, including diplomas, job references, and language certificates.

Step 3:Submit your application through the official German Immigration portal.

Step 4:Wait for approval and migrate to Germany

How much proof of funds is required for a Germany job seeker visa? ›

For both Option 1 and Option 2, you must have sufficient financial resources to fund your job search in Germany. During the visa process, you can demonstrate this ability with a blocked bank account (containing a minimum of €1,027 net per month, amount applicable in 2024) or a declaration of commitment.

What is the Opportunity Card Germany 2024? ›

From June 1, 2024, applicants from non- EU countries can gain the Opportunity Card to look for a suitable job in Germany. The Opportunity Card replaces the Jobseeker Visa. You can find information about the necessary documents on our information sheet on the Opportunity Card.
